Formal safety assessments by the Cosmetic Ingredient Review (CIR), Scientific Committee on Consumer Safety (SCCS), or Food and Drug Administration (FDA) specifically for Methyl Ethylcarbamate (CAS 6135-31-5) in cosmetics have not been identified. While other carbamate compounds, such as ethyl carbamate (a known carcinogen), have been subject to toxicity studies, this information is explicitly stated not to directly apply to Methyl Ethylcarbamate. The absence of specific irritancy or sensitization data leaves its topical safety profile largely undetermined.
